vue動(dòng)態(tài)切換css樣式 vue 頁(yè)面切換動(dòng)畫

為什么VUE的路由切換組件的時(shí)候css不銷毀不是按需加載

1、如果在另外一個(gè)bundle,按需加載。會(huì)在加載后出現(xiàn)在document中。所以,用在style里用scoped控制吧。

讓客戶滿意是我們工作的目標(biāo),不斷超越客戶的期望值來(lái)自于我們對(duì)這個(gè)行業(yè)的熱愛(ài)。我們立志把好的技術(shù)通過(guò)有效、簡(jiǎn)單的方式提供給客戶,將通過(guò)不懈努力成為客戶在信息化領(lǐng)域值得信任、有價(jià)值的長(zhǎng)期合作伙伴,公司提供的服務(wù)項(xiàng)目有:域名與空間、網(wǎng)站空間、營(yíng)銷軟件、網(wǎng)站建設(shè)、團(tuán)風(fēng)網(wǎng)站維護(hù)、網(wǎng)站推廣。

2、vue腳手架(vue-cli)所支持的就是盡可能的提高用戶體驗(yàn)設(shè)計(jì),通過(guò)路由減少頁(yè)面訪問(wèn)次數(shù)達(dá)到頁(yè)面無(wú)刷新切換。也就是單頁(yè)面應(yīng)用。題主所說(shuō)的“多頁(yè)面應(yīng)用”其實(shí)是沒(méi)有什么意義的。

3、可能是因?yàn)闉g覽器緩存了樣式文件導(dǎo)致??梢栽赾ss文件引用的末尾隨便加個(gè)請(qǐng)求參數(shù),如:main.css?v=201804091834,瀏覽器就以為是個(gè)新文件,然后從服務(wù)器重新下載該文件。

4、最近發(fā)現(xiàn)一個(gè)比較奇怪的問(wèn)題,就是在開發(fā)vue中,路由點(diǎn)擊跳轉(zhuǎn)到另外一個(gè)組件中,樣式是不出來(lái)的,然后刷新當(dāng)前頁(yè)面css樣式才加載出來(lái),找了好久才發(fā)現(xiàn)這個(gè)bug。

vue.js怎么動(dòng)態(tài)設(shè)置css

1、首先,必須確保定義了CSS類名,然后在模板中創(chuàng)建類綁定。在本文的其他部分,我將詳細(xì)解釋這些步驟。

2、推薦對(duì)于僅使用 JavaScript 過(guò)渡的元素添加 v-bind:css=false ,Vue 會(huì)跳過(guò) CSS 的檢測(cè)。這也可以避免過(guò)渡過(guò)程中 CSS 的影響。

3、在Vue.js的模板中,通過(guò)`v-on`指令綁定`mousemove`事件,然后在事件處理函數(shù)中計(jì)算鼠標(biāo)位置的坐標(biāo)值。 根據(jù)計(jì)算得到的鼠標(biāo)位置坐標(biāo)值,動(dòng)態(tài)改變頁(yè)面元素的顏色,可以通過(guò)計(jì)算屬性或者直接在模板中使用條件語(yǔ)句來(lái)實(shí)現(xiàn)。

4、今天開始學(xué)習(xí)Vue.js的使用,但是在學(xué)習(xí)過(guò)程中發(fā)現(xiàn)一個(gè)問(wèn)題,那就是頁(yè)面加載數(shù)據(jù)時(shí),原始代碼會(huì)閃現(xiàn)一下。查訪各方資料,終的解決方法。

5、Vue.js的指令是以v-開頭,它們用于HTML元素,指令提供了一些特殊的特性,將指令綁定在元素上時(shí),指令會(huì)為綁定的目標(biāo)元素添加一些特殊的行為,我們可以將指令看作特殊的HTML特性。

vue3點(diǎn)擊之后加css樣式

color:#2c3e50; margin-top:60px;}可以將css樣式寫在外部,再通過(guò)下面三種方法中的一種引入:在入口js文件main.js中引入,一些公共的樣式文件,可以在這里引入。

以往我們使用js或Jquery添加或移除元素的類(class),搭配CSS中定義好的樣式,再引用一些javascript庫(kù)之后,可以做作出非常復(fù)雜,驚艷的動(dòng)態(tài)效果,不過(guò)這套方法還是太繁瑣。

如果從第一個(gè)tab到第六個(gè)tab的索引是0,1,2,3,4,5。那么滑塊的公式就是(索引*tab的寬度)。大家看到有逐漸過(guò)去的效果,其實(shí)是css3過(guò)渡(transition)的效果。

CSS變量?jī)?yōu)勢(shì)其實(shí)很明顯,上面案例中, A元素 并沒(méi)有寫style,而且, a-container 是可以復(fù)用的,可以用在無(wú)數(shù)個(gè)元素上。最后,在標(biāo)簽里可以定義偽元素的樣式。

vue+js動(dòng)態(tài)切換element-ui生成的主題css文件

直接編輯 element-variables.scss 文件,例如修改主題色為紅色。

vue如何使用element-ui 創(chuàng)建相應(yīng)文件。

可以使用一個(gè)用來(lái)引入css文件的組件 template /template export default { data () { return { theme: your-custom-theme } } }注:以上代碼沒(méi)有經(jīng)過(guò)測(cè)試,純理論指導(dǎo)。

這次給大家?guī)?lái)怎樣利用Vue自定義動(dòng)態(tài)組件,利用Vue自定義動(dòng)態(tài)組件的注意事項(xiàng)有哪些,下面就是實(shí)戰(zhàn)案例,一起來(lái)看一下。現(xiàn)在基于vue的UI組件庫(kù)有很多,比如iview,element-ui等。

文章標(biāo)題:vue動(dòng)態(tài)切換css樣式 vue 頁(yè)面切換動(dòng)畫
當(dāng)前URL:http://muchs.cn/article4/dgjcooe.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供虛擬主機(jī)、建站公司、網(wǎng)站設(shè)計(jì)、營(yíng)銷型網(wǎng)站建設(shè)網(wǎng)站改版、小程序開發(fā)

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)

外貿(mào)網(wǎng)站建設(shè)